Haglöff fastest in TCR Scandinavia official test

26 April 2018

Twenty-one drivers took part in the TCR Scandinavia official test that took place today at Ring Knutstorp.
During the morning session, Daniel Haglöff clocked the fastest lap of 59.913 that was also the new track record for TCR cars, three tenths faster than the previous one set by Fredrik Ekblom last year. Haglöff was followed by the reigning champion Robert Dhalgren (59.945) and TCR rookie Philip Morin (1:00.053); all three of them were at the wheel of Cupra TCR cars run by the PWR Racing.
Fredrik Ekblom was the best of the rest, in the WestCoast Racing Volkswagen Golf GTI (1:00.190) followed by fellow VW-driver Johan Kristoffersson of Kristoffersson Motorsport (1:00.412). Micke Ohlsson of Brink Motorsport classified seventh and the best of the Audi RS3 LMS drivers (1:00.518).
During the session Experion Racing’s Albin Wärnelöw crashed his Golf GTI at Turn 4; he was taken to the hospital and released after medical checks; however he could not rejoin the test because his car was massively damaged.
In the afternoon session, Mattias Andersson completed a lap of 1:01.866 in his Honda Civic FK2 just before the rain began to pour preventing everybody else from going faster.
The TCR Scandinavia will kick off at Knutstorp on 4/5 May.
